Logo of the United States National Park Service, an agency of the United States Department of the Interior. The elements on the logo represent the major facets of the national park system. The Sequoia tree and bison represent vegetation and wildlife, the mountains and water represent scenic and recreational values, and the arrowhead represents historical and archeological values. The bison is also the symbol of the Department of the Interior. The logo became the official logo on July 20, 1951, replacing the previous emblem of a Sequoia cone, and has been used ever since. The design was slightly updated in 2001, and a few different renderings are used today. For more information, see here and here. |

Public domain from a copyright standpoint, but other restrictions apply. First, the logo is a registered trademark. Also, the logo cannot be used in violation of 18 U.S.C. § 701, 18 U.S.C. § 712, and 36 C.F.R. Part 11. Also see the NPS usage policy. Uses require written permission from the Director of the National Park Service (Reg. No 3,175,869; Nov. 28, 2006). |
